How To Use Airplay on Chromecast
Mirror iPhone/iPad using Airplay on Chromecast
You can use Airplay to show the screen of your iPhone or iPad to Chromecast in the same way.
- Open the Airscreen app on Chromecast, after the initial setup you will see a name on which you will share the content.
- Now, Open your iPhone Control Center by swiping it down from the battery icon size on the home screen.
- Tap the Screen Mirroring button. The iPhone will start looking for active devices nearby it.
- Once your Chromecast name that is displayed on the TV screen appears in the available devices list, select it by tapping it.
- Your iPhone’s screen will now start mirroring on your TV. The content from the iPhone will start appearing on the bigger screen of the TV. To control the content being displayed on Chromecast TV you can use the iPhone.
- To stop mirroring your iPhone after you have finished watching your content, simply tap the Screen Mirroring button again under the iOS Control center.
- Then tap on Stop Mirroring.
Mirror Mac using Airplay on Chromecast
- Open the Airscreen app on Chromecast, after the initial setup you will see a name on which you will share the content.
- Now Click on the Control center >> Screen Mirroring on your Mac that is placed at the top-right corner of the screen.
- After that, you will see a list of devices available to mirror, now click on your Chromecast name that is displayed in the Airscreen app.
- Mirroring starts from your Mac on Chromecast using Airplay.
- To stop mirroring open the Control center >> Screen Mirroring and click on the chromecast name once again.

Can I use AirPlay with Chromecast? AirPlay is Apple’s built-in way to cast. It’s too bad that it doesn’t work with Chromecast devices. To stream video from your Apple device to your Chromecast, you will need to use one of the third-party apps we talked about above.
